es.davy.ai

Preguntas y respuestas de programación confiables

¿Tienes una pregunta?

Si tienes alguna pregunta, puedes hacerla a continuación o ingresar lo que estás buscando.

MySQL no se inicia: innodb-default-row-format=dynamic

Reinicié la computadora esta mañana y WAMPSERVER no logra iniciar MySQL 8.0.26.

El archivo de registro contiene lo siguiente:

2021-12-16T11:11:56.631237Z 0 [System] [MY-010116] [Servidor]
c:\wamp64\bin\mysql\mysql8.0.26\bin\mysqld.exe (mysqld 8.0.26)
iniciando como proceso 4896

2021-12-16T11:11:56.645789Z 0 [ERROR] [MY-000077] [Servidor] c:\wamp64\bin\mysql\mysql8.0.26\bin\mysqld.exe:
Error al establecer el valor 'dynanmic' para 'innodb-default-row-format'.

2021-12-16T11:11:56.646988Z 0 [ERROR] [MY-010746] [Servidor] Error al analizar
opciones para el complemento 'InnoDB'.

2021-12-16T11:11:56.647364Z 0
[ERROR] [MY-010168] [Servidor] Fallo al inicializar los complementos integrados.

Si comento la línea “innodb-default-row-format=dynamic”, entonces MySQL se iniciará, pero no entiendo las consecuencias de tener esa línea comentada.

No he encontrado nada relacionado con este problema específico en mis búsquedas.

¡Cualquier conocimiento o solución será muy apreciado!

Tags:  ,

Answer

  1. Avatar for davy.ai

    Solución para el problema de inicio fallido de MySQL 8.0.26 en WAMPSERVER

    El archivo de registro publicado indica que MySQL 8.0.26 falla al iniciar en WAMPSERVER debido a un error al establecer el valor “dynamic” en “innodb-default-row-format”. Para resolver esto, puedes intentar la siguiente solución:

    1. Abre el archivo my.ini en la carpeta de MySQL utilizando un editor de texto.
    2. Comenta la línea “innodb-default-row-format=dynamic”.
    3. Guarda el archivo y reinicia WAMPSERVER.
    4. Verifica si MySQL se inicia sin problemas.

    Aunque comentar la línea puede resolver el problema, es importante entender las consecuencias de esta acción. La opción “innodb-default-row-format” determina el formato de fila predeterminado utilizado por las tablas InnoDB. Si la opción no está configurada, el valor predeterminado es “dynamic”, lo que puede provocar consultas más lentas debido al uso de campos de longitud variable.

    Sin embargo, esto puede no tener un impacto significativo en el uso del sistema. Por lo tanto, puedes considerar probar el comportamiento de tu sistema con y sin la opción “innodb-default-row-format” y luego decidir la mejor opción para tu caso de uso específico.

Comments are closed.